British doubles legend Jamie Murray has announced his retirement from tennis. The 40-year-old was the first British doubles player to rise to world No.1 and is a seven-time grand slam champion.
The elder brother of three-time grand slam singles champion Andy Murray has officially hung up his racket, aged 40.
